I find local technicians to be more reliable, I remember a few years ago my computer got broken and since I bought it from bestuby, i went there and they had it for like 3 months. No computer for 3 months, and now that I have average experience I realize that the problem was simpler than It was. The whole thing was free but I hated it anyway, horrible service. As for locals, I’ve got it back in a few hours for small and big problems
